As a measure of volume, Chönix was a measure of antiquity and was different in different cultures. One generally understood this measure to be an ordinary amount of grain for a person's daily diet.

  • Greeks 1 Chönix = 4 Kotylä / Kotule = 1/48 Medimnos (1 Medimno = 52.8 liters) = 1.1 liters
  • Romans 1 Chönix = 2 sextarii
  • 1 chönix = 180 drachmas
